s390/gmap: voluntarily schedule during key setting



[ Upstream commit 6d5946274df1fff539a7eece458a43be733d1db8 ]

With large and many guest with storage keys it is possible to create
large latencies or stalls during initial key setting:

rcu: INFO: rcu_sched self-detected stall on CPU
rcu:   18-....: (2099 ticks this GP) idle=54e/1/0x4000000000000002 softirq=35598716/35598716 fqs=998
       (t=2100 jiffies g=155867385 q=20879)
Task dump for CPU 18:
CPU 1/KVM       R  running task        0 1030947 256019 0x06000004
Call Trace:
sched_show_task
rcu_dump_cpu_stacks
rcu_sched_clock_irq
update_process_times
tick_sched_handle
tick_sched_timer
__hrtimer_run_queues
hrtimer_interrupt
do_IRQ
ext_int_handler
ptep_zap_key

The mmap lock is held during the page walking but since this is a
semaphore scheduling is still possible. Same for the kvm srcu.
To minimize overhead do this on every segment table entry or large page.

/*
 * Give a chance to schedule after setting a key to 256 pages.
 * We only hold the mm lock, which is a rwsem and the kvm srcu.
 * Both can sleep.
 */
static int __s390_enable_skey_pmd(pmd_t *pmd, unsigned long addr,
				  unsigned long next, struct mm_walk *walk)
{
	cond_resched();
	return 0;
}

static int __s390_enable_skey_hugetlb(pte_t *pte, unsigned long addr,
				      unsigned long hmask, unsigned long next,
				      struct mm_walk *walk)
@@ -2601,12 +2613,14 @@ static int __s390_enable_skey_hugetlb(pte_t *pte, unsigned long addr,
	end = start + HPAGE_SIZE - 1;
	__storage_key_init_range(start, end);
	set_bit(PG_arch_1, &page->flags);
	cond_resched();
	return 0;
}

static const struct mm_walk_ops enable_skey_walk_ops = {
	.hugetlb_entry		= __s390_enable_skey_hugetlb,
	.pte_entry		= __s390_enable_skey_pte,
	.pmd_entry		= __s390_enable_skey_pmd,
};
